From August 3 to 31, 2020, the Chinese Alumni Association of Latvia  and the Chinese Embassy in Latvia jointly organized an online Sinology seminar, hosted by Karina Jermaka, the President of the Chinese Alumni Association of Latvia, and a total of 9 scholars gave ten lectures. The Chinese Side Director of the Confucius Institute at the University of Latvia Shang Quanyu, Latvian Side Director Peteris Pildegovics, and Secretary Marija Jurso respectively gave lectures titled “Chinese Names and Appellations”, “Beijing Historical Spots and Parks”, and “Song Dynasty Flower and Bird Painting” .

Professor Shang Quanyu talked about the origin, composition, characteristics, historical evolution and cultural meaning of Chinese names and appellations. Professor Pildegovics lived in Beijing for four years and worked in the Latvian Embassy in China and Xinhua News Agency. He is very familiar with Beijing’s historical sites and parks. He combined his personal experience and his profound knowledge of Sinology to vividly describe the importance of Beijing cultural sites and parks. Marija studied Chinese painting at the Faculty of Fine Arts of South China Normal University, and then studied for a Master’s degree in Sinology at the University of Helsinki. During that time, she went to Peking University to study the history of Chinese art and Chinese painting. Marija told about the origins, genres, representative figures and masterpieces of flower and bird painting in Song Dynasty.

This is the first online Sinology seminar in Latvia, attracting a large number of Chinese language enthusiasts, further promoting Chinese culture, and receiving a warm welcome and response from Chinese language enthusiasts.
